#849558 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#849558 is composed of 51.8% red, 58.4%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 11.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 40.9%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 76.7 degrees, a saturation of 25.7% and a lightness of 46.5%. #849558 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ffb0 with #092b00. Closest websafe color is: #999966.

#849558 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#849558 has RGB values of R:132, G:149,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0.11, M:0, Y:0.41, K:0.42. Its decimal value is 8688984.

Shades and Tints of #849558
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010101 is the darkest color, while #f7f8f4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#849558
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#787a73 is the less saturated color, while #a8e706 is the most saturated one.
